Need a junkyard ECM: Where is it located?
Hello,
I have a 5.3 LS1 from an 03 or 04 Chevy truck. I was supposed to get an ECM with this motor but never received it. I'm going to go to the local pull-a-part and try to find another one but I don't know where it is located in the truck. Does anyone know? Is there anything I should try to look for to make sure I get a good one? Thanks, Brandon |
|
||||
|
under hood...on left fenderwell, low, to the right of the battery and fusebox.
